The goal of this clinical trial is to find out whether stimulating the brain with electrical current during naps can increase certain kinds of brain activity that happen during sleep and lead to improvements in emotional health and stress resilience. Participants will attend up to 3 study visits, each of which may last up to 4-5 hours. During these visits, participants will wear a high density electroencephalography (hdEEG) cap and take a nap.
